Output 7b630bb5b6573c72f01f39eefb0cf6c35ba1b39b99a27f2fcf68a50cb43d4095:2

value
491760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c8b65007a39930d24e3c84060c681b58d067e94 OP_EQUALVERIFY OP_CHECKSIG
address
154Xik61yfWqaYXTFXz3SP9KtHBeCc26k6
transaction
7b630bb5b6573c72f01f39eefb0cf6c35ba1b39b99a27f2fcf68a50cb43d4095
spent
true